Transaction 5dcc85d240d8c124b1dc2217d29f9397474c62864dd9a94471f01af38db06c44

2 Input
2 Outputs
  • 5dcc85d240d8c124b1dc2217d29f9397474c62864dd9a94471f01af38db06c44:0
  • value  20000000
    address  1NzXfuwyg2wEEYh5AiNgBDgd83rWzMR8Tw
  • 5dcc85d240d8c124b1dc2217d29f9397474c62864dd9a94471f01af38db06c44:1
  • value  11037303
    address  3GfspTC9hPYT5V9QtHsMR1EUfqesq6iFPA